I am looking for information on selling my Dad's 1954 Super MTA. He has passed and we don't have anyone in the family that would like it. Where should we start looking to sell it and where do we start with pricing. I

its a long ways from original. a repaint and decals and power steering. dont class as original.
 
Agree with rustred. Neither does the air cleaner jar. Plus it looks like a beaver has been chewing on the hood where the muffler comes through. Plus those hoods are about 1/2" longer than a SM Hood so finding a perfect one is getting harder to find.
 
Does the TA work on it? Buyers will want to know. I suggest you get it running before trying to sell. It looks like it has set a while
 
Sorry I didn't answer your questions. I was just agreeing with rustred and pointing out things that weren't original.
SMTAs are still somewhat popular. I would suggest that you get it running so you know if the TA works, if the tranny is quiet or noisy, if the front end is loose, if the brakes work or not. If you sell it as is you will have a hard time getting close to what it is worth. Non running I would say $1000- $1500 if the rear tires match. Less if they don't. Craigs list is a place to start with a for sale ad.
